Section 2: Developing Climate-Resilient Infrastructure

The Postgraduate Certificate in Climate Resilience and Adaptation Planning also emphasizes the importance of developing climate-resilient infrastructure. By incorporating climate-resilient design principles into infrastructure planning, graduates can help communities build roads, bridges, and buildings that can withstand the impacts of climate-related hazards. For example, in the aftermath of Hurricane Katrina, the city of New Orleans invested heavily in climate-resilient infrastructure, including the construction of a new levee system and the restoration of wetlands to provide natural barriers against storm surges. Graduates of this course could work with local governments and engineers to develop similar infrastructure projects in other communities around the world.

Section 3: Supporting Climate-Smart Agriculture and Water Management

Climate change is also having a profound impact on agriculture and water resources, with changing weather patterns and increased frequency of extreme events threatening food security and water availability. The Postgraduate Certificate in Climate Resilience and Adaptation Planning highlights the importance of supporting climate-smart agriculture and water management practices. For example, in Africa, climate-smart agriculture initiatives have helped farmers adapt to changing weather patterns by implementing conservation agriculture techniques and using drought-tolerant crop varieties. Graduates of this course could work with farmers, governments, and NGOs to develop and implement similar initiatives in other regions around the world.
